If 95% of the students are present in a school, then the number of absent students is 5% of the total number of students. We are given that the number of absent students is 25, so we can set up an equation:
0.05x = 25
Solving for x, we get:
x = 25 / 0.05 = 500
Therefore, the total number of students in the school is 500.

Given data ,
Let the total cost of the sweater be represented as A
Now , the equation will be
The cost of sweater without discount and sales tax = $ 47.99
The discount percentage = 20 %
The cost of sweater after discount = 47.99 - ( 20/100 ) x 47.99
On simplifying the equation , we get
The cost of sweater after discount = 47.99 - 9.598
The cost of sweater after discount = $ 38.392
Now , the percentage of sales tax = 6 %
The cost of sweater after sales tax = 38.392 + ( 6/100 ) x 38.392
On simplifying the equation , we get
The cost of sweater after sales tax = 38.392 + 2.30352
The cost of sweater after sales tax = $ 40.695
Therefore , the value of A is $ 40.69
Hence , the final cost of the sweater is $ 40.69
